Definition
- 1A list or set of people or entities to be shunned or banned, disallowed or blocked.
Recorded use
Wiktionary exampleThese source excerpts show how blacklist appears in context. They illustrate usage; the definition above remains the entry’s reference meaning.
The software included a lengthy blacklist of disreputable websites to block.
Etymology
From black + list.
